Squids and octopuses forcefully expel water through the siphon after ingesting it, propelling themselves through the water. Third Law of Newton.
His third law asserts that there is an opposite and an equal response in nature for every action (force). When an object A pulls on an object B, the opposite force is applied to the first object by object B. Alternatively said, interactions lead to forces.
There are numerous real-world applications of Newton's third motion law. For instance, when you leap, the earth exerts an equal and opposing reaction force that propels you into to the air. This is because when you apply a force to it with your legs, it responds in kind. Rockets and other projectiles are designed using Newton's third law by engineers.

Ventilation is very important if there is a risk of exposure to radon gas in your home or school because ventilation will help you not to inhale all of the radon particles in your body. Radon gas is dangerous because it does not smell and you cannot see it with your own eyes. Also, it is very toxic and radioactive.

Each element is uniquely and completely identified by its Atomic Number. This is the number of protons in the nucleus, which is equal to the number of electrons in the neutral atom.The Atomic Number of Magnesium is 12.An atom’s Mass Number is the number of protons plus the number of neutrons in its nucleus.For Mg-25 the Mass Number is 25.So 25 = (number of protons) + (number of neutrons)= 12 + (number of neutrons)
